The International Series Macau returns to Macau Golf and Country Club with a $2 million prize purse and three spots in The Open Championship up for grabs. The tournament features several LIV Golf League stars including Major winners Sergio Garcia and Patrick Reed.

Defending champion John Catlin headlines the field alongside fellow LIV Golf players including Abraham Ancer, David Puig, and recent LIV Golf Riyadh winner Adrian Meronk. Other notable participants include Anthony Kim, YouTube star Luke Kwon, and Graeme McDowell.

The event is part of the PIF-backed International Series, featuring 10 elevated Asian Tour events that offer a potential pathway to the LIV Golf League through end-of-year standings.

Prize Money Breakdown:

  • Winner: $360,000
  • Runner-up: $220,000
  • Third place: $126,000
  • Fourth place: $100,000
  • Fifth place: $82,000

The Macau Golf and Country Club, one of the oldest established golf clubs in Southern China, hosts the tournament. The par-70 course measures under 7,000 yards and has hosted notable winners including Colin Montgomerie, Lee Westwood, and Min Woo Lee since its inception in 1998.
